Buxton's 2024 was encouraging, when healthy... By now, you know the deal with Byron Buxton (OF, MIN): when healthy, he'll deliver lots of fantasy value, but he's never healthy for a full season. 2024 was no exception, as he spent 48 days on the IL in addition to days off for rest and recovery; when he played, he posted an .859 OPS, his best mark since 2021, and a strong rebound after a big batting average drop in 2023.
